Event Partners

FEAST OF FIRE SPONSORS

Gallagher Estates helps create communities by promoting and developing mixed use schemes across the UK and we have played a significant role in the development of Milton Keynes over the last decade. In the last three years we have sold serviced parcels of land to seven house builders who are currently delivering around 500 private and affordable homes per year in Milton Keynes. We were delighted to open the first primary school on the Western Expansion Area last year, and are pleased to announce a second one will be open this year with a secondary school scheduled for 2020. www.gallagherestates.co.uk

IDI Gazeley is one of the world’s leading investors and developers of logistics warehouses and distribution parks, with 50 million square feet of premier assets under management near major markets and transport routes in North America and Europe. This year, 2017, is a special year for IDI Gazeley as we celebrate our 30th anniversary in Europe. Established since 2004, our Magna Park Milton Keynes is one of the largest European logistics parks with nearly 4 million square feet developed for national and international customers. www.idigazeley.com 

centre:mk is a Grade-II listed building in Milton Keynes which spans 1.3 million sq ft of prime retail space and provides 190 retail units. One of the UK’s top 10 shopping and leisure destinations, it boasts a tenant line-up that includes John Lewis, Marks & Spencer, House of Fraser and an impressive range of UK and international brands. www.thecentremk.com

Feast of Fire has been created for MK50 and City Club by Walk the Plank working with IF: Milton Keynes International Festival and The Stables.

Supported by Arts Council England, Milton Keynes Council, The Rothschild Foundation, MK Community Foundation, PRS for Music Foundation, MK Dons Sports & Education Trust, Milton Keynes Development Partnership and YMCA Milton Keynes.
